Featured Chamber Events
The Camrose Chamber of Commerce throughout the year hosts several events to help premote the City and County of Camrose and all of the Chamber member's businesses.

The Camrose Chamber also has their monthly General Meeting Luncheons. These happen on the first Wednesday of each month and are open to all of the Chambers members. The lunches consist of a great meal followed by a speaker who is usually local and talks about things pertaining to the Camrose area and businesses.

Above: The Chambers Annual Jaywalkers Jamboree is a huge event that closes down Main Street. With crazy rides, shopping at it's best, and so much food that you wouldn't know what to do with it, this is one of the biggest Events of the summer, and also the oldest continous running street fair in Alberta! |
"Be a Tourist in your own Town Week" is a week long event that starts off with a "Kick-off Barbeque". After the Barbeque the Chamber has events planned all week in which you can find out more about this great community and what there is to do and see. With events like "Creative Arts for Kids", "Family Activity Day", Train rides for kids on the Camrose Chamber's Train or a Photo Scavenger hunt, it's a great week for everyone.
